The 13th regional freshman tourny was held yesterday (2/7). First rounds were held at Knox Central and Barbourville. With the semi-finals and finals held at Knox Central. Knox Central won it by beating South Laurel in the finals. There were 10 teams in the tourny. First round Clay beat Lynn Camp....Bell beat North. Second round Corbin beat Pineville....Knox beat Bell......South beat Middlesboro......Clay beat Barbourville. Semi-finals....Knox beat Corbin....South beat Clay. Knox beat South in the finals. Great tourny.....would have been better if all the teams would have been able to participate.
